Is enabling Chrome Flags safe?

Chrome Flags are experimental features that aren’t part of the default Chrome experience. They haven’t gone through the extensive testing required to make it into the main version of Chrome. Proceed with caution. Flags aren’t tested for security.

What does Chrome canary do?

Chrome Canary is Google’s cutting edge web browser aimed at developers, experienced techies, and browser enthusiasts. If you enjoy experimenting with new web browsers, then it might be for you.

What is Chrome GPU process?

The GPU process is a process used only when Chrome is displaying GPU-accelerated content. Chrome uses GPU to accelerate web-page rendering, typical HTML, CSS, and graphics elements. In the latest chrome, even the video was offloaded to the graphics chip. Basically it serves two purposes. GPU takes less power than CPU.

What is the difference between Google Chrome and Google canary?

The core difference between Google Chrome and Canary is the updates they receive. Chrome is available in four release channels “Stable, beta, dev and canary”. The standard Chrome receives stable and tested updates while the Canary supplied with brand new updates for those who want to try out them.

Is Chromium and Google Chrome the same?

The biggest difference between the two browsers is that, while Chrome is based on Chromium, Google also adds a number of proprietary features to Chrome like automatic updates and support for additional video formats.

What is the “enable network service” experiment?

“The experiment, called “Enable network service,” tells Chrome to launch a separate process for “ service workers ,” or background tasks for web pages. A few bugs in service workers, combined with the network service experiment, is inadvertently bypassing Chrome extensions.
